Not all 90-yard touchdown drives are equal.

St. Mary’s (Stockton, Calif.) put the spotlight on that theory Friday night against No. 21 De La Salle (Concord, Calif.) when a pass from the 20-yard line turned into a referee-screened scamper toward the end zone, a broken tackle, and a fumble that was recovered just before the ball scooted out the back of the end zone—and a lead change in the third quarter, which could have very well ended the Spartans’ Super 25 run almost as quickly as it started.
